Brief Summary
This study is to evaluate the efficacy of the Kreiger/Kunz method of Therapeutic Touch on function, pain perception and quality of life in persons with Osteoarthritis in the knee.

Study Arms (2)
Arm 1
ACTIVE COMPARATORThis arm received the Kreiger/Kunz method of Therapeutic Touch in addition to Standard of Care
Arm 2
NO INTERVENTIONStandard of Care

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Persons diagnosed with or exhibiting signs of osteoarthritis of at least one knee.
You may not qualify if:
- Persons with connective tissue disorder
- Persons with bilateral total joint replacement of the knee
- Persons with dementia
- Persons with a systemic illness producing joint symptoms
